Earlywine
Earlywine is on Rocky Creek and State Highway 105, six miles from Brenham in east central Washington County. It was named for the Wren community's nineteenth-century postmaster, John W. Earlywine. The Harris Spring Church is in the Earlywine vicinity. The 1984 county highway map showed two businesses at Earlywine.
